Output edb7e7bfa8e9fcb158138c350369931073d0d92a5fa3572cfa187a3bfa04d37d:91

value
9509179
script pubkey
OP_0 OP_PUSHBYTES_20 50e909622ad92b57832531dfbd3022dcd36b05d6
address
bc1q2r5sjc32my440qe9x80m6vpzmnfkkpwkzc788w
transaction
edb7e7bfa8e9fcb158138c350369931073d0d92a5fa3572cfa187a3bfa04d37d
spent
true